Mae
Mae is an adorable little 11 year old black female pug who is blind due to previously untreated dry eye & ulcers. She will need to be on eye drops for the rest of her life, but is otherwise in good health. Mae can be very temperamental and will snap unprovoked (most likely due to her lack of vision). She was recently started on a medication that we hope will help to ease her anxiety and make her more happy.
Yoda
Yoda is an approx. 12 year old girl who came to NIPRA in November of 2007. She has what is believed to be degenerative disc disease in her spine, which causes her to have some weakness in her hind end and has left her incontinent. She wears a diaper in the house and is on a prescription diet for urinary issues. Yoda cannot go up or down stairs on her own but she is still a very spunky girl who loves to play with toys. As her mobility decreases, she will most likely need the assistance of a doggy wheelchair. Luckily, a generous NIPRA supporter has donated a used cart that Yoda will be able to use when that time comes.
Sara
Sara is an approx. 14 year old fawn female pug with a very sweet disposition. She came to us when her previous owner had to move into an assisted living facility and could not take Sara along. Sara is house trained, loves people, and is very good at wagging her tail. She is very healthy & still kind of spunky for her age.
